Step 1: Love them like they are your brother/sister.
By giving the homeless person cash, it can be easily converted to drugs and alcohol. , By taking time and actually talking to a homeless person in a friendly and very respectful manner, you can give them a wonderful sense of civility and dignity.
Just by being friendly, it gives the person a weapon to fight the isolation, depression, and paranoia that many homeless people face daily. , The homeless are commonly very diverse.
A homeless person you meet could be a battered woman, an addicted veteran and so on. , Always be very cautious when talking to street people. stay in areas where other people can see you.
Don't take any chances. ,, -
